Show the mountain who wears the pants when you get vertical in the Arc'teryx Gamma SV Softshell Pant. Even if the snowy, rocky giant tries to assert dominance, rest assured knowing you're protected by Arc'teryx's stretchy, breathable, water- and wind-resistant Fortius 3.0 fabric.

  • Gusseted crotch allows full range of motion for more acrobatic moves on technical faces
  • Ample pockets help organize your snack, camera, and emergency transmitter
  • Stretch pant cuffs with adjustable drawcords and lace hooks allow you to fully seal out cold and snow

If you are using it as a midlayer they are both fine choices. As an outer layer you will fell the bite of the wind. They are not windproof softshells so once the temps drop and you are moving down the hill the wind cuts through the shell. They are best served as a mid layer for cold days and an outer layer when the skies are sunny and the temps are just around the freezing mark.

Is the cuff on these pants large enough to fit around ski boots

Is the cuff on these pants large enough to fit around ski boots for ski mountaineering?

The cuff on the Gamma MX will fit tightly over lower profile ski mountaineering boots, but it would be tough to get them over a standard Alpine boot. You may want to check the Gamma SK, which offers similar weather protection, a bit more breathability and a larger cuff that will easily fit over any ski boot and offers a mini-gaiter.

Material:
Fortius 3.0 (65% polyester, 20% nylon, 15% polyurethane), DWR coating 
Fabric Waterproof Rating:
water-resistant 
Fabric Breathability Rating:
highly breathable 
Insulation:
none 
Fit:
trim 
Venting:
none 
Side Zips:
no 
Gaiters:
no 
Waist:
integrated webbing belt with buckle closure 
Pockets:
2 zippered hand, 2 thigh laminated zip 
Weight:
24.6 oz 
Recommended Use:
alpine/expedition climbing 
Manufacturer Warranty:
lifetime
